What Factors are Driving Its Growth in the Licensed Sports Merchandise Market?
The licensed sports merchandise market has witnessed significant growth, reaching USD 33.5 billion in 2024 and is expected to reach USD 44.7 billion by 2033, with a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 3.2%. Key drivers include major sporting events, growing fan engagement, and collaborations between sports organizations and apparel brands. The rise of e-commerce platforms and the increasing inclination of fans to showcase their team allegiance through branded merchandise are further fueling the market.

What Are the Major Growth Factors for the Licensed Sports Merchandise Market?
Technological Advancements in Merchandise Customization
The rising use of technology like AR and VR is changing how fans connect with licensed sports gear. This tech lets shoppers customize items, making buying more enjoyable. It also offers virtual try-ons and 3D views for customers to see products before they buy. This personalization and fun interaction is set to boost market growth, especially online, as fans wanna bond with teams in fresh ways.
Expansion of Global Sports Events
The boom in sports leagues and competitions has greatly increased the allure of licensed sports merchandise. Events like the FIFA World Cup, Olympics, and many local tournaments have ramped up fan interest and demand for official gear. As sports events attract bigger and more varied crowds, it’s clear fans wanna show their support for teams and players. This growth is backed by media exposure, which shines a light on sports events and pushes merchandise sales worldwide, especially in newer markets.
E-Commerce and Social Media Influence
Online shopping sites are key in reshaping the licensed sports merchandise market, giving fans simpler access to products. Social media ads and online shops connect sports brands directly with fans for more tailored marketing and focused campaigns. This online trend, along with rising incomes and expanding internet access in developing areas, is spurring global merchandise sales. The convenience of shopping for sports gear from home and social media's effect on buying choices are major factors for future licensed sports merchandise market growth.

Which Region is Dominating the Licensed Sports Merchandise Market?
North America and Europe head the licensed sports merchandise market, backed by strong sports leagues like the NFL, NBA, and UEFA. With devoted fan bases and higher disposable incomes, demand for merchandise continues to grow. Asia-Pacific is stepping up as a growing area, driven by a surge in global sports like soccer, basketball, e-sports, and shifting cultural trends favoring Western sports.
What Are the Latest Trends in the Licensed Sports Merchandise Market?
In July 2024, Fanatics and New Zealand Rugby formed a big new partnership. This boosts global fan interaction for teams like the All Blacks and Black Ferns. This alliance not only enhances how official merchandise is sold but also broadens the reach of New Zealand Rugby merchandise around the globe. The deal shows how vital e-commerce and all-around shopping experiences are for elevating fan interaction and making licensed sports gear more accessible worldwide.
